Paul,

 

Well, according to the TCK's comments, static member injection IS optional.
That said just to get this far means I have a significant portion of the
work done to make it 100% pass the tck, and I'm kind of with the mindset
that since we're this far, go for it for "buzzword compliance" even if we
don't recommend the use of static member injection.

 

I think I'll peel the logic out into separate injectors that are turned off
by default but still included in Adapting injection.  That way a person
could explicitly turn it on with:

 

pico.as(STATIC_INJECTION).addComponent(..);

 

but it would sit in a default "off" state.  This would also help with
keeping track of statics initialization on a  per-container basis.  If
somebody wants to share a class across multiple unconnected containers, only
the container with STATIC_INJECTION turned on for the component registration
would be initializing the statics.

Mike,

 

I'm not really happy with JSR330's patronage of injection into class
variables.  If we had to say we're not going to do it, but we'll do
everything else from JSR 330 that's instance based, then I'd not be unhappy.

 

Can we do it in a separate class?  StaticEnabledPicoContainer (implements
MPC, has-a DPC) ?  Then it's a take it or leave it thing.

Ok, so this is the last thing on the todo list to get the TCK + all optional
tests running for JSR-330.

 

The TCK wants static initialization, but to keep track of things so that we
only inject statics one time.

 

To me that means we have to maintain some sort of state about what's been
initialized, but what scope?

 

Do we do it across all containers?  (ie a static variable inside default
picocontainer)  (for the record, my own personal opinion on this solution.
ick!)

 

Personally I'm of the opinion that we keep track of static initialization
once per container.  (via a Non static member variable, probably a
WeakHashSet. weak so it doesn't prevent classloaders from gc'ing a class?)  

 

If we have multiple containers (not in a parent-child way) referencing the
same class, then it would mean that a static variable will be initialized
multiple times, but personally I think this is an edge case behavior that we
can live with compared to having to have Static variables inside DPC.  

 

I suppose a complicated way would be to run a class enhancer to offload the
state information there. but that seems like a lot of work for what we would
call an recommended way of doing things.
